Understanding Common Problems



Determining typical problems in product packaging machines is vital for maintaining operational performance and reducing downtime. Packaging makers, essential to manufacturing lines, can encounter a range of problems that prevent their performance. One prevalent concern is mechanical malfunction, typically arising from deterioration on components such as belts and equipments, which can lead to irregular product packaging top quality.


One more usual issue is misalignment, where the product packaging materials might not align correctly, creating jams or incorrect securing. This misalignment can originate from incorrect arrangement or changes in product specifications. In addition, electrical failings, such as malfunctioning sensing units or control systems, can interrupt the equipment's automated procedures, causing manufacturing delays.


Operators may likewise experience difficulties with software glitches, which can impact maker shows and functionality. Moreover, insufficient upkeep techniques often contribute to these problems, highlighting the requirement for normal inspections and timely solution treatments. By recognizing these common problems, drivers can execute aggressive steps to make certain peak efficiency, thereby decreasing pricey downtimes and boosting general performance in packaging procedures.

Analysis Devices and Strategies



Reliable troubleshooting of product packaging equipments relies greatly on a variety of analysis devices and methods that help with the recognition of underlying problems - packaging machine repair service. One of the key devices is making use of software analysis programs, which can check maker efficiency, evaluate mistake codes, and offer real-time information analytics. These programs make it possible for specialists to determine specific malfunctions swiftly, substantially lowering downtime


Along with software program solutions, multimeters and oscilloscopes are essential for electric diagnostics. Multimeters can gauge voltage, current, and resistance, assisting to determine electric faults in circuits. Oscilloscopes, on the other hand, provide visualization of electrical signals, making it easier to find irregularities in waveforms.


Mechanical concerns can be identified utilizing vibration analysis tools and thermal imaging electronic cameras. Resonance analysis permits the discovery of imbalances or misalignments in machinery, while thermal imaging assists recognize overheating components that may bring about mechanical failing.


Last but not least, visual evaluations, integrated with standard checklists, continue to be vital for basic troubleshooting. This detailed method to diagnostics makes certain that service technicians can effectively attend to a wide variety of concerns, consequently improving the dependability and performance of packaging devices.


Security Protocols to Follow



Just how can product packaging maker drivers make certain a safe workplace while repairing? The implementation of stringent security protocols is vital. Operators ought to begin by detaching the maker from its power resource before launching any troubleshooting procedures. Lockout/tagout (LOTO) methods should be imposed to stop unexpected re-energization during upkeep.

Parts Substitute Standards



When it concerns maintaining product packaging makers, comprehending parts substitute guidelines is important for guaranteeing optimal efficiency and durability. On a regular basis evaluating wear and tear on equipment elements is essential, as timely substitutes can avoid much more extensive damages and expensive downtime.


First of all, always describe the producer's specifications for advised substitute intervals and component compatibility. It is essential to make use of OEM (Original Equipment Maker) parts to ensure that substitutes meet the needed quality and performance criteria.


Prior to beginning any kind of replacement, ensure the machine is powered look at this web-site down and properly secured out to stop unintentional activation. Paper the condition of the replaced components and the day of replacement, as this will aid in tracking upkeep fads over time.


In addition, examine the bordering components for signs of wear or potential problems that might arise from the replacement. This alternative strategy can minimize future problems and enhance operational effectiveness.


Last but not least, after changing any parts, conduct detailed testing to guarantee that the maker is operating appropriately and that the new parts are integrated article perfectly. Complying with these standards will certainly not just expand the life of your product packaging equipment but also improve overall efficiency.


Maintenance Finest Practices



Regular upkeep methods are crucial for taking full advantage of the performance and life-span of product packaging equipments. Developing a comprehensive maintenance schedule is the very first step toward making sure ideal efficiency. This routine must include daily, weekly, and month-to-month jobs tailored to the specific maker and its operational demands.


Daily checks need to concentrate on crucial parts such as seals, sensing units, and belts, guaranteeing they are tidy and working correctly. Weekly upkeep may involve examining lubrication degrees and tightening up loose installations, while regular monthly tasks need to include much more in-depth analyses, such as placement checks and software application updates.




Utilizing a list can enhance these procedures, making sure no vital tasks are ignored. Additionally, keeping accurate documents of maintenance tasks helps recognize persisting problems and informs future methods.


Training personnel on proper use and handling can substantially lower damage, stopping unnecessary break downs. Additionally, buying high-quality components and lubricating substances can enhance equipment performance and reliability.
